The size of Ballarat East is approximately 6 square kilometres. It has 15 parks covering nearly 21% of total area. The population of Ballarat East in 2011 was 5,308 people. By 2016 the population was 5,612 showing a population growth of 5.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Ballarat East is 20-29 years. Households in Ballarat East are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Ballarat East work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 60% of the homes in Ballarat East were owner-occupied compared with 56.7% in 2016.
